Analysis of recent ultraviolet observations of the Capella binary system (Alpha Aur) indicates a dense geometrically narrow chromosphere-corona transition region in the Capella system primary (G5 III) similar in many respects to a solar active region. An examination of the coronal energy balance, together with the coronal base pressure derived from the line fluxes, predicts a corona with a mean temperature of 1.2 million K and a large stellar wind consistent with observations.
